‎CHÂTELAIN (Henry Abraham).‎

‎[PARAGUAY/CHILI/TERRE DE FEU] Carte du Paraguai, du Chili, du Détroit de Magellan &c.‎

‎[Amsterdam, circa 1720]. 402 x 515 mm.‎

‎Belle carte détaillée figurant le Paraguay, le Chili et la Terre de Feu, dérivée de Guillaume de l'Isle. Elle a été dressée d'après les descriptions des pères jésuites Alfonse d'Ovalle et Nicolas Techo, et sur les relations et mémoires de Brouwer, Narbouroug et de Beauchesne. Elle est enrichie de notes, comme au nord de l'Argentine où figure le "Pays des Pampas ainsi nommez des plaines qu'ils habitent". La carte montre en pointillés les routes des grands explorateurs : Vespucci en 1502, Magellan en 1520, Sarmiento en 1589, de La Roche en 1675 ou encore Halley en 1700. Dans l'Atlantique Sud, on peut voir le navire d'Amerigo Vespucci. La carte est issue de l'Atlas Historique, véritable encyclopédie géographique et l'œuvre de Nicolas Gueudeville pour le texte et d'Henry Abraham Châtelain pour les cartes. La première édition fut publiée à Amsterdam en 1708, puis rééditée en 1718, 1721 et 1732-39. Bel exemplaire.‎

‎CHÂTELAIN (Henry Abraham).‎

‎Carte de la Barbarie, Nigritie et de la Guinée avec les pays voisins.‎

‎[Amsterdam, circa 1720]. 399 x 508 mm.‎

‎Belle carte détaillée figurant la partie nord-ouest de l'Afrique, dérivée de Guillaume de l'Isle. Elle s'étend au sud jusqu'au Gabon et l'île du Prince, dans l'archipel de Sao Tomé-et-Principe, et à l'est jusqu'à la Lybie et le Tchad. Les nombreux royaumes de la région sont enrichis de notes sur leurs populations, leur géographie et leurs productions. Ainsi, dans le royaume de Bournou, situé à l'est du Tchad, figurent des "Déserts et passages dangereux et pleins de voleurs" et "de bonnes mines de fer", dans le royaume du Soudan, "des roches de Tegasa d'où l'on tire du sel dont se chargent les caravanes de Maroc et de Tombut", dans le royaume de Bito (entre le Nigeria et le Cameroun), "les habitans sont riches", et dans le royaume voisin de Temian, "les habitans sont à ce qu'on dit antropophages". Dans la ville de Zala, au royaume du Faisan, situé au sud du royaume de Tripoli, "il y a des foires et des marchez célèbres". La carte est issue de l'Atlas Historique, véritable encyclopédie géographique et l'œuvre de Nicolas Gueudeville pour le texte et d'Henry Abraham Châtelain pour les cartes. La première édition fut publiée à Amsterdam en 1708, puis rééditée en 1718, 1721 et 1732-39. Bel exemplaire.‎

‎CHÂTELAIN (Henry Abraham).‎

‎Nouvelle carte de géographie de la partie méridionale de l'Amérique suivant les plus nouvelles observations avec des tables et des remarques pour l'intelligence de l'Histoire et de la Géographie.‎

‎Amsterdam, [circa 1720]. 467 x 597 mm.‎

‎Belle carte de l'Amérique Latine, dérivée de la carte de Guillaume de l'Isle. Tandis que les côtes sont très détaillées, de vastes régions à l'intérieur des terres, non encore suffisamment explorées, ont été laissées vides, en particulier le nord-ouest du Brésil, appelé Pays des Amazones, et l'Argentine, appelée Terre Magellanique. Le nord est appelé Terre Ferme. La Terre Ferme ou Tierra Firme était le nom donné du temps de la colonisation de l'Amérique par la couronne espagnole au Venezuela, à l'Isthme de Panama et à une partie des territoires de la Colombie. Les routes des explorateurs dans le Pacifique sont signalées en pointillés : Magellan en 1520, Mendaña et Gallego en 1568 et 1595, Sarmiento en 1579, van Noort en 1600, ou encore Le Maire et Schouten en 1616. La carte est issue de l'Atlas Historique, véritable encyclopédie géographique et l'œuvre de Nicolas Gueudeville pour le texte et d'Henry Abraham Châtelain pour les cartes. La première édition fut publiée à Amsterdam en 1708, puis rééditée en 1718, 1721 et 1732-39. Bel exemplaire, replié.‎

‎CHÂTELAIN (Henry Abraham).‎

‎Nouvelle carte de l'Amérique septentrionale dressée sur les plus nouvelles observations de Messieurs de l'Académie des Sciences et des meilleurs géographes avec des tables très instructives et curieuses de la division de tous les états et les différents souverains qui en sont possesseurs.‎

‎[Amsterdam, circa 1720]. 472 x 598 mm.‎

‎Belle carte de l'Amérique du Nord, dérivée de la carte de Guillaume de l'Isle. Elle s'étend au nord jusqu'au Groenland et au sud jusqu'à la Colombie et le Venezuela. La Californie y est correctement représentée comme une péninsule. Représentée comme une île jusqu'à la fin du XVIIe siècle, c'est Guillaume de l'Isle qui lui rendit sa forme correcte de péninsule. Presque toute la partie ouest des États-Unis a été laissée vide, tandis que le reste de la carte est très détaillé, avec notamment les noms des tribus indiennes. Une longue table donne la liste des possessions aux Antilles pour chaque pays, ainsi qu'un arbre généalogique de l'Amérique du Nord avec les peuples et les différents souverains qui se la partagent. Les routes des grands explorateurs sont représentées en pointillés : Hernán Cortés en 1534, Olivier van Noort en 1600, Juan Gaetan en 1542, Alvaro de Mendaña ou encore Francis Drake. La carte est issue de l'Atlas Historique, véritable encyclopédie géographique et l'œuvre de Nicolas Gueudeville pour le texte et d'Henry Abraham Châtelain pour les cartes. La première édition fut publiée à Amsterdam en 1708, puis rééditée en 1718, 1721 et 1732-39. Bel exemplaire, replié. Légère fausse pliure verticale.‎

‎CIVIL WAR. ABRAHAM LINCOLN‎

‎Attending the Philadelphia Sanitary Fair in the Summer of 1864‎

‎<p>Two tickets to the Great Central Fair in Philadelphia. One admitted a pupil of the public schools of Philadelphia and was used on Saturday June 11 according to the stamp on the verso. The other is an apparently unused "Season Ticket" that admitted the bearer "<i>To All Parts of the Fair</i>" except the Children's Exhibitions but was "<i>Forfeited if Transferred and Not Good unless Endorsed</i>." The verso includes the oath "<i>I hereby promise that this Ticket shall be used to obtain admission to the Fair by myself only</i>" and a blank line for a signature.</p> <b>CIVIL WAR. ABRAHAM LINCOLN.</b>Great Central Fair Tickets June 1864. Pair of passes for the Great Central Fair held in Philadelphia June 7-28 1864. One ticket is for one day's admission for a public school student. The other is a season ticket. 1 p. each 3½ x 2¼ and 3½ x 2 in.<p><b><br /></b></p><p><b>Historical Background</b></p><p>During the Civil War several northern cities hosted sanitary fairs between 1863 and 1865 to raise money for the care of wounded soldiers. The Great Central Fair held at Logan Square in Philadelphia in June 1864 was a fundraiser for the United States Sanitary Commission and was one of the largest fairs. The main exhibit building constructed in forty working days by local volunteer skilled labor enclosed 200000 square feet. It featured nearly one hundred departments offering a broad range of displays from Arms and Trophies to Fine Arts to Umbrellas and Canes. Curiosities included a $1000 doll house a recreated parlor of William Penn with Penn artifacts the boat used by Arctic explorer Elisha Kent Kane and George Washington's carriage.</p><p>Over three weeks the fair welcomed more than 400000 visitors. The season ticket offered here cost $5 a week's pay for a day laborer or a domestic and several days' wages for skilled workers. The fair served more than 9000 meals per day in its restaurant and had a daily newspaper with descriptions of the various departments. During its existence the fair raised approximately $1 million for the Sanitary Commission second only to New York City in money raised.</p><p>President Abraham Lincoln attended the fair with his family on June 16. He also donated forty-eight signed copies of the Emancipation Proclamation printed under the auspices of George Boker of the Union League which were sold for $10 each.</p><p><b>Condition</b></p><p>Both have glue discolored on the reverse sides. The smaller card has a 1" edge tear on the right side neatly repaired with archival tape.</p><br />‎

‎Civil War: Lincoln Abraham: Cook John Pope‎

‎GENERAL ORDERS No. 139. THE FOLLOWING PROCLAMATION BY THE PRESIDENT IS PUBLISHED FOR THE INFORMATION AND GOVERNMENT OF THE ARMY AND ALL CONCERNED: BY THE PRESIDENT OF THE UNITED STATES OF AMERICA A PROCLAMATION. contained in: A THREE-VOLUME SET OF GENERAL ORDERS TO THE UNION ARMY FROM THE OFFICE OF THE ADJUTANT GENERAL COVERING 1861 AND 1862 COLLECTED BY BRIGADIER GENERAL JOHN POPE COOK‎

‎Washington D.C.: War Department Adjutant General's Office 1862. Three volumes with over 300 individual imprints. 12mo. Uniformly bound in contemporary three-quarter roan and marbled boards gilt leather labels. Wear to leather and edges boards somewhat rubbed front hinges tender. Contemporary ownership inscriptions and binder's tickets on front endpapers of second and third volumes; later bookplate on front pastedown of first volume. Light toning in places otherwise internally clean. Very good. A uniformly-bound set of General Orders issued by the Adjutant General's Office of the War Department in Washington D.C. previously owned by Brig. Gen. John Pope Cook. The orders cover 1861 and 1862 and comprise a nearly complete run of orders for the Union Army during the first two years of the Civil War. Undoubtedly the most significant General Order in this collection is a preliminary printing of the Emancipation Proclamation. A handful of the orders are signed in ink by the various adjutant generals. The Emancipation Proclamation bound in the third volume is as follows: GENERAL ORDERS No. 139. THE FOLLOWING PROCLAMATION BY THE PRESIDENT IS PUBLISHED FOR THE INFORMATION AND GOVERNMENT OF THE ARMY AND ALL CONCERNED: BY THE PRESIDENT OF THE UNITED STATES OF AMERICA A PROCLAMATION caption title. Washington D.C.: War Department Adjutant General's Office ca. Sept. 24 1862. 3pp. This work is one of the earliest printings of the Preliminary Emancipation Proclamation issued to regimental commanders in the field during the Civil War in the week after President Lincoln's official manuscript version was finished. Here the third paragraph rings out with Lincoln's timeless words: "That on the first day of January in the year of our Lord one thousand eight hundred and sixty-three all persons held as slaves within any State or designated area of a State the people whereof shall then be in rebellion against the United States shall be then thenceforward and forever free." Following the Seven Days Battle and Gen. McClellan's retreat from the Peninsula at the end of June 1862 President Lincoln realized that there would be no early end to the war and found himself "as inconsolable as it was possible for a human to be and yet live." Anxious for news from the army and needing to escape the constant interruptions at the White House he frequently visited the telegraph office in the War Department building to await dispatches. It was during one such visit early in July that he asked the chief of the telegraph staff Maj. Thomas Thompson Eckert for some paper to "write something special" and began the first draft of the Emancipation Proclamation completing it in a few weeks. Lincoln had long hoped to resolve the slavery issue through a congressional act of emancipation compensating slave owners for their loss of "property" but that approach was roundly rejected by representatives from the border states leaving the President who had decided upon the necessity of emancipation with a presidential proclamation as the only option. The extraordinary document he conceived would announce the liberation on the 1st of January 1863 of all slaves in those states still in rebellion against the Union and promised compensation to slave owners in those states that returned to the fold before that time if they adopted "immediate or gradual abolishment of slavery." This proclamation would be followed by a final proclamation issued on the 1st of January identifying those states still in rebellion and confirming the liberation of all slaves therein. On Tuesday July 22 Lincoln presented his draft to the Cabinet telling them that he had resolved firmly upon the course of action it specified and asking them not for advice but suggestions. The only observation he had not anticipated came from Secretary of State Seward who proposed that it might be best to wait for a military victory before issuing the Proclamation as it could otherwise seem like "the last measure of an exhausted government." Immediately recognizing the wisdom of the suggestion Lincoln held back. On September 17th after an anxious wait of nearly two months he received the victory he needed at the bloody Battle of Antietam. Completing his final draft Lincoln presented it to his cabinet for refinement on September 22nd. Following the meeting Seward took the amended draft with him to the State Department where a formal manuscript copy was made then signed by Lincoln and Seward. The first edition of the Preliminary Emancipation Proclamation Eberstadt #1 a small three-page circular intended for distribution within the government and to the local press was likely printed on the 22nd of September. At the time that Charles Eberstadt published his study of the Proclamation 1950 he was able to locate only one copy which he himself owned and as nearly as we have been able to determine no other copies have come to light since then. Eberstadt #2 is a supposed second edition no copy of which Charles Eberstadt was able to locate whose existence he inferred from the standard State Department practice of printing a folio edition consisting solely of the text of the proclamation followed by another printing consisting of the text of a letter of transmittal from the Secretary of State as well as the text of the proclamation. While there may be a copy of Eberstadt #2 in the National Archives as he speculated it is not recorded in their online catalog nor have we been able to find a copy in any other online catalog including OCLC the Library of Congress and the Abraham Lincoln Library. Eberstadt's third printing of the Preliminary Emancipation Proclamation is without a doubt the earliest obtainable printing. It consists of Secretary of State Seward's one-page letter of transmittal addressed "To the Diplomatic and Consular Officers of the United States in foreign countries" and the text of the proclamation. Eberstadt located a total of only five copies in institutions at the Library of Congress the National Archives Yale the Clements Library and Brown. OCLC does not record any additional copies nor is it recorded in Monaghan. This firm sold a copy several years ago. The present copy of GENERAL ORDERS No. 139 is Eberstadt's fourth printing of the Preliminary Emancipation Proclamation dated in print on September 24. Charles Eberstadt surmises that this field order printing could have been accomplished as late as September 29 or 30 and produced in as many as 15000 copies. It is however rather uncommon in the market and this is the first copy of this printing of the Preliminary Emancipation Proclamation offered by this firm. "From the first days of the Civil War slaves had acted to secure their own liberty. The Emancipation Proclamation confirmed their insistence that the war for the Union must become a war for freedom. It added moral force to the Union cause and strengthened the Union both militarily and politically. As a milestone along the road to slavery's final destruction the Emancipation Proclamation has assumed a place among the great documents of human freedom" - National Archives. "The proclamation has been called by responsible persons one of the three great documents of world history ranking with Magna Carta and the Declaration of Independence" - Eberstadt. Besides including about 300 orders on all manner of Union military activity at the outset of the Civil War the present collection also contains the 1861 printing of REGULATIONS FOR THE UNIFORM AND DRESS FOR THE ARMY OF THE UNITED STATES. Set out in GENERAL ORDERS No. 6 this twenty-four-page printing of the Army dress regulations was the first to set out uniform requirements for the Union during the conflict. The first sentence of the first section requires officers to "wear a frock coat of dark blue cloth." Thus the Blue and the Gray begins. This set was collected and bound by John Pope Cook who began the Civil War as a colonel in command of the 7th Illinois Volunteer Regiment. He was promoted to brigadier general after his troops played a key role in the Union victory at Fort Donelson early in 1862. After his promotion he was transferred to a command in the Department of Iowa and Dakota Territory where he remained until early 1863 conducting campaigns against the Sioux from his base at Sioux City Iowa. These orders must have been bound near the end of this period since contemporary labels note the binder one William F. Kiter as being from relatively close by Council Bluffs. A very early printing of one of the most important political acts in the Civil War and indeed in American history contained in a set of General Orders contemporaneously assembled by a significant Union Army commander. EBERSTADT LINCOLN'S EMANCIPATION PROCLAMATION 4. War Department, Adjutant General's Office hardcover‎
